Why Conventional Wisdom on Cross-Functional Collaboration Falls Short in International Expansion

Most assume that cross-functional collaboration platforms, such as those with AI-powered workflow automation or embedded analytics, suffice for managing teams across borders. However, these platforms do not inherently solve cultural nuances or operational logistics critical to new markets. For example, a centralized data science team’s models may fail in local contexts due to missing regional variables or regulatory constraints. Similarly, product teams focused on feature rollouts may overlook local usability adaptations without input from regional marketing and customer success teams.

Delegation is often misunderstood in this context. Giving local teams autonomy without clear frameworks risks fragmentation; conversely, over-centralizing decision-making leads to bottlenecks. Effective cross-functional collaboration requires a deliberate blend of global oversight and local empowerment, supported by structured communication rhythms and transparent KPIs.

Framework for Cross-Functional Collaboration in International Expansion

This framework breaks down into four essential components for business development managers:

  1. Localized Team Structures with Clear Roles
    Create cross-functional pods that pair central AI-ML experts with regional domain specialists, marketing, product, and logistics leads. Each pod handles a defined geography and market segment, promoting ownership and faster adaptation. For instance, a team in Europe might include GDPR compliance officers alongside data engineers to ensure models respect local privacy laws.

  2. Delegation and Escalation Pathways
    Define decision rights explicitly. Local teams should handle market-specific product adjustments and customer engagement, while central teams maintain underlying model architecture and data pipelines. Escalation protocols streamline issues like data quality concerns or vendor disputes back to core teams.

  3. Process Alignment Across Cultures
    Standardize key processes — such as sprint planning, data validation, and user feedback loops — but allow flexibility in execution to accommodate cultural workstyles and holidays. Using asynchronous communication tools (e.g., Slack, Microsoft Teams) integrated with analytics platforms helps maintain a continuous dialogue across time zones.

  4. Measurement and Feedback Loops

Balancing Localization, Cultural Adaptation, and Logistics

Localization in AI-ML analytics platforms often means more than translating UI or marketing materials. It encompasses tailoring data models to local economic indicators, consumer behavior, and competitive landscapes. For example, a pricing optimization model effective in the U.S. market might require recalibration for Asia-Pacific’s varying purchasing power and regulatory tariffs. This demands close collaboration between product managers, data scientists, regional market analysts, and legal teams.

Cultural adaptation affects team interaction norms. Managers should recognize that direct communication valued in one culture may clash with indirect styles preferred elsewhere. Setting explicit norms for meetings, decision-making, and conflict resolution supports smoother collaboration. Logistics add another layer: coordinating feature rollouts aligned with local infrastructure readiness, payment gateways, and shipping partners requires cross-team synchronization.

Business development managers must juggle these dynamics while using the right platforms. Tools that integrate project management, data analytics, and communication help, but none replace strong team governance.

Delegation and Team Processes for BigCommerce-Focused Expansion

BigCommerce users demand specific integrations such as e-commerce analytics, inventory optimization, and localized marketing automation. Cross-functional teams must include:

  • Data Engineers and ML Ops Specialists to customize data ingestion pipelines for regional order patterns and shipping logistics.
  • Product Managers focused on adapting user experience for local shopper behavior.
  • Regional Marketing for cultural messaging and channel optimization.
  • Sales and Customer Support aligned with localized payment methods and return policies.

Delegation frameworks should empower local leads to make tactical decisions on promotions or inventory adjustments, reporting upstream on outcomes via dashboards built on AI-ML insights.

Implementing agile ceremonies adapted to time zones ensures cadence and accountability. For example, asynchronous sprint reviews with recorded demos allow distributed teams to stay updated despite time differences.

Cross-Functional Collaboration Team Structure in Analytics-Platforms Companies?

Optimal team structure for international AI-ML analytics-platform firms builds on modular pods combining centralized expertise with local market insights. Each pod typically involves:

  • Data Scientists and Engineers for model development
  • Product Owners for feature localization
  • Legal and Compliance stakeholders for regional adherence
  • Marketing and Sales representatives for customer feedback and demand generation

Such structures reduce handoff delays and foster faster iteration cycles. Coordination across pods happens through regular global leadership syncs and shared performance dashboards.

This model also supports incremental international rollouts, where learnings from initial markets refine subsequent expansions.

Cross-Functional Collaboration ROI Measurement in AI-ML?

Measuring ROI involves both quantitative and qualitative metrics:

  • Increase in market share or revenue per region
  • Reduction in time-to-market for localized features
  • Improvement in model performance against local benchmarks
  • Employee engagement and satisfaction with collaboration processes

Surveys from Zigpoll combined with platform usage analytics offer leading indicators of collaboration health. It is critical to set baseline metrics before expansion, enabling comparison over time.

Beware that some benefits, such as enhanced team morale or long-term customer loyalty, may not be immediately visible on financial dashboards but are essential for sustainable growth.

Scaling Cross-Functional Collaboration Beyond Initial Markets

Once foundational processes and teams for international collaboration prove effective, scaling requires:

  • Codifying best practices into playbooks
  • Automating routine workflows within collaboration platforms
  • Expanding pods with templated roles and responsibilities
  • Strengthening executive sponsorship to maintain alignment and resource allocation

Managers should continuously revisit delegation frameworks as the number of markets grows, preventing both micromanagement and siloed decision-making.
